Tasks
- Oversee and mentor a team of four designers, providing guidance, feedback, and support to ensure high-quality work.
- Develop the brand’s visual identity with a fresh creative approach.
- Validate and approve design projects, ensuring they meet the company’s standards and client expectations.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for clients, understanding their needs, presenting ideas, and managing feedback.
- Lead the development and execution of brand strategies that align with client goals and market trends.
- Manage multiple design projects simultaneously, ensuring timely delivery and effective communication between the team and clients.
- Work closely with other departments, including marketing, presales, and HR, to ensure cohesive brand messaging.
- Stay current with industry trends and tools, bringing fresh ideas and innovative solutions to the team and clients.
- Minimum of 7 years in a design role, with at least 3 years in a leadership position.
- Expertise in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ign).
- Strong experience in presentation design and the ability to create engaging visual narratives.
- Strong understanding of branding, typography, color theory, and layout design.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- Proven 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ines.
- Strong leadership and mentoring abilities.
- A compelling portfolio showcasing a range of branding and presentation projects and your role in their execution.
- English at least B2.
